Output 343ba693013d607b24aaeba5850d5a5f3057bda15974501ffe8a6808a2ac979e:5

value
586364
script pubkey
OP_0 OP_PUSHBYTES_20 e94ae979fe20d07213c3689ee4c2d0840cde6abc
address
bc1qa99wj707yrg8yy7rdz0wfsksssxdu64uzpcrq2
transaction
343ba693013d607b24aaeba5850d5a5f3057bda15974501ffe8a6808a2ac979e
spent
true